Global Audio Critical Communication Market to Reach USD 6.94 Billion by 2033, Driven by Public Safety Modernization and Industrial Digitalization – Phoenix Research

New Delhi,4 October 2025
The Global Audio Critical Communication Market is entering a transformative growth phase as both public-sector and industrial users prioritize resilient, mission-critical voice systems to support real-time coordination, worker safety, and emergency response. From first responders and utilities to oil & gas operators and transportation networks, organizations are upgrading legacy voice systems to advanced LTE/5G-based and hybrid communication platforms that ensure always-on, low-latency, and interoperable audio connectivity across dispersed teams and critical operations.

According to the latest report by Phoenix Research, the global audio critical communication market is projected to grow from USD 4.22 billion in 2025 to approximately USD 6.94 billion by 2033, registering a CAGR of 6.0% during the forecast period. In 2024, North America held the largest share (~38.0%) due to mature public-safety infrastructure, while Asia Pacific is expected to be the fastest-growing region, expanding at a CAGR of 7.5% driven by rapid urbanization, industrial expansion, and investments in private broadband networks.

Key Drivers of Market Growth

1. Public Safety Modernization & Interoperability Mandates
Governments and emergency-response agencies are replacing outdated LMR systems with IP-based, interoperable voice platforms. Phoenix’s Sentiment Analyzer Tool reveals rising procurement momentum for MCPTT-enabled systems supporting seamless cross-agency communication.

2. Shift to Broadband (LTE/5G) & Hybrid Architectures
The migration from narrowband PMR to broadband and hybrid LMR–LTE systems is enabling new features—location tracking, multimedia dispatch, and advanced analytics—without compromising on reliability and security.

3. Industrial Digitalization & Worker Safety
Critical voice systems are increasingly being adopted by industrial sectors such as oil & gas, utilities, mining, and manufacturing. Rugged devices and intrinsically safe headsets are essential for on-site communication and worker protection in hazardous environments.

4. Managed Services, Cloud Dispatch & Subscription Models
Cloud-hosted communication and managed-service models reduce capital costs while improving scalability and feature rollouts. Phoenix’s Construction Activity Mapping System shows a notable rise in managed audio communication projects in municipal and enterprise sectors.

5. Device & Accessory Innovation (Rugged, Wearables, Headsets)
Technological advances in headsets, bone-conduction audio, and wearable communication gear enhance clarity and comfort for users operating in high-noise, high-stress environments—driving replacement and upgrade cycles.

Regional Highlights

North America – CAGR (2025–2033): 5.5% (Largest Region)

  • Driven by large-scale modernization of public safety networks, regional interoperability programs, and rapid private LTE adoption for enterprise and municipal use.

Asia Pacific – CAGR (2025–2033): 7.5% (Fastest Growing Region)

  • Infrastructure investments, expanding industrial bases, and private broadband rollouts across Southeast Asia are fueling adoption.

Europe

  • Sustained by upgrades to TETRA systems and increased interoperability initiatives across utilities and transport networks.

Latin America & Middle East & Africa (MEA)

  • Strong growth in MEA’s energy and infrastructure projects, and rising modernization efforts across LATAM’s public-safety networks.
